The Best Natural Oils for Lash Growth
1. Castor Oil – The Growth Booster
Castor oil is the holy grail of lash growth. It’s packed with ricinoleic acid, which helps stimulate hair follicles and encourage thicker, longer lashes. It also contains vitamin E and proteins that keep lashes strong and prevent shedding.
💡 How to Use It:
- Dip a clean mascara wand or cotton swab into castor oil.
- Gently apply it along your lash line before bed.
- Leave it overnight and rinse off in the morning.
2. Coconut Oil – The Strengthener
Coconut oil isn’t just for your hair—it works wonders on lashes, too! It penetrates deep into the hair shaft, preventing protein loss and keeping lashes from becoming weak and brittle.
💡 How to Use It:
- Take a small amount on your fingertips.
- Lightly massage it onto your lashes and lash line.
- Leave it on overnight for best results.
3. Olive Oil – The Hydrator
Olive oil is rich in omega-3 fatty acids and vitamin E, which help moisturize and strengthen lashes. It also contains antioxidants that protect against damage caused by pollution and makeup products.
💡 How to Use It:
- Use a clean spoolie to apply a few drops of olive oil.
- Brush it onto your lashes from root to tip.
- Let it sit for a few hours or overnight.
4. Argan Oil – The Protector
Argan oil is loaded with essential fatty acids and antioxidants that keep lashes soft, hydrated, and resistant to breakage. If your lashes are damaged from excessive mascara use, argan oil can help restore their health.
💡 How to Use It:
- Dab a drop of argan oil onto a cotton pad.
- Gently apply it to your lashes before bed.
- Repeat daily for best results.
5. Vitamin E Oil – The Repairing Agent
Vitamin E oil is known for its healing properties. It strengthens weak lashes, prevents premature breakage, and supports new lash growth.
💡 How to Use It:
- Open a vitamin E capsule.
- Apply the oil directly to your lashes using a cotton swab.
- Leave it on overnight.

Tips for Using Natural Oils on Your Lashes
Now that you know which oils work best, let’s go over some pro tips to get the best results.
1. Always Use Cold-Pressed, Organic Oils
Not all oils are created equal. Processed oils often lose their nutrients. Look for 100% pure, cold-pressed, organic oils to ensure you’re getting the most benefits.
2. Be Consistent
Lash growth doesn’t happen overnight. You need to use these oils daily for at least 4–6 weeks to see noticeable results.
3. Apply at Night for Maximum Absorption
Your body repairs itself while you sleep. Applying oils before bed allows your lashes to soak up all the goodness overnight.
4. Use a Clean Applicator
Never dip a used mascara wand into your oil. Use a clean spoolie or cotton swab every time to avoid bacteria buildup.
5. Remove Eye Makeup Gently
Rubbing your eyes aggressively while removing makeup weakens your lashes. Instead, soak a cotton pad with micellar water or coconut oil and gently wipe away makeup.
Common Myths About Natural Oils and Lashes
There’s a lot of misinformation out there about lash care. Let’s clear up some common myths.
❌ “Natural oils make lashes grow overnight.”
Nope! Lash growth is a slow process. While oils help strengthen and nourish, expect visible results in 4–6 weeks with consistent use.
❌ “More oil means faster growth.”
Using too much oil can clog hair follicles and cause irritation. A tiny drop is enough to work its magic.
❌ “Only expensive products can fix weak lashes.”
Not true at all! Natural oils can be just as effective as high-end lash serums—without the hefty price tag.
